Danesfield is a small residential development situated on the outskirts of Ripley village and close to walks and countryside. Papercourt Lake is within a moments walk providing beautiful, scenic walks. The residents of Danesfield enjoy a sense of community, often getting together for various celebrations throughout the year.

Ripley is an historic and sought-after village in Surrey popular with all walks of life: families, young professionals and downsizers alike. The village is said to have the largest village green in England (approximately 65 acres) and enefits from a fantastic selection of award-winning café’s, shops, pubs and restaurants. Pinnocks Coffee House on the High Street has been awarded Best Coffee Shop in Surrey. For something more relaxed there is also a wide selection of local pubs to choose from.
